WebCation/H+ (NHX-type) antiporters are important regulators of intracellular ion homeostasis and are critical for cell expansion and plant stress acclimation. In Arabidopsis (Arabidopsis thaliana), four distinct NHX isoforms, named AtNHX1 to AtNHX4, locate to the tonoplast. Complete answer: Eukaryotic cells such as … small birds of northern wisconsinWebMay 1, 2024 · The pH of plant vacuole ranges from 3 to 10. Due to an abundant quantity of alkaline substances, its pH may increase to 9-10. Similarly, due to the presence of acids like citric acid, oxalic acid, and tartaric acids, pH can lower to 3.
